I'm using a rubber stamp from Viva Las VegaStamps today...it's a stamp created from the illustrations of Sir John Tenniel--they have several made into stamps at VLVS.

 I created this little fat book page on a piece of canvas paper...I began by swirling on distress ink with my beautiful Enchanted Vine RebeccaBaer.com Collage stencil...the same stencil is later used to get the diamond pattern on the bottom right and the Swirl at the top left. You're here to HOP!  The image was stamped on a piece of scrapbooking paper made to look like a dictionary page. As the image was bigger than my 4◊4" square, I altered slightly to get both the Cheshire Cat and Alice on the page. The cat and Alice and a piece of the branch were colored with Prisma Pencils and then painted with Ranger Perfect Pearls Mist in Pearl to add SHIMMER. The cat needed some googly eyes to finish him off.

Detail of the stenciled swirls and emboss pasted stencil.
copper creams were lightly brushed over the top of the raised stenciling.
Detail of the swirl in the upper left.
Again, copper creams were brushed over the swirls to help them pop.
